stm32: Add support for a board to reserve certain peripherals.
Allows reserving CAN, I2C, SPI, Timer and UART peripherals. If reserved the peripheral cannot be accessed from Python. Signed-off-by: Damien George <damien@micropython.org>

diff --git a/ports/stm32/mpconfigboard_common.h b/ports/stm32/mpconfigboard_common.h
index a73a26b16..8890abc59 100644
--- a/ports/stm32/mpconfigboard_common.h
+++ b/ports/stm32/mpconfigboard_common.h
@@ -127,6 +127,31 @@
#define MICROPY_HW_FLASH_FS_LABEL "pybflash"
#endif
+// Function to determine if the given can_id is reserved for system use or not.
+#ifndef MICROPY_HW_CAN_IS_RESERVED
+#define MICROPY_HW_CAN_IS_RESERVED(can_id) (false)
+#endif
+
+// Function to determine if the given i2c_id is reserved for system use or not.
+#ifndef MICROPY_HW_I2C_IS_RESERVED
+#define MICROPY_HW_I2C_IS_RESERVED(i2c_id) (false)
+#endif
+
+// Function to determine if the given spi_id is reserved for system use or not.
+#ifndef MICROPY_HW_SPI_IS_RESERVED
+#define MICROPY_HW_SPI_IS_RESERVED(spi_id) (false)
+#endif
+
+// Function to determine if the given tim_id is reserved for system use or not.
+#ifndef MICROPY_HW_TIM_IS_RESERVED
+#define MICROPY_HW_TIM_IS_RESERVED(tim_id) (false)
+#endif
+
+// Function to determine if the given uart_id is reserved for system use or not.
+#ifndef MICROPY_HW_UART_IS_RESERVED
+#define MICROPY_HW_UART_IS_RESERVED(uart_id) (false)
+#endif
+
/*****************************************************************************/
// General configuration
